Denver Basin bedrock
Confined sandstone aquifer; negligible human-timescale recharge — pumping is one-way storage mining.
Because this aquifer does not recharge on a human timescale, a decline here is storage being removed, not a stream being short. It is kept out of the stream-depletion math for that reason.
Water-level record
16 measurements from 1986-05-30 to 2001-05-15. Most recent water-level elevation 5080.0 ft, 550.0 ft below ground.
Over the record the level is decreasing at -94.81 ft per decade (p = 0.0191, n = 16). Mann–Kendall with the Hamed–Rao autocorrelation correction, on water-level elevation; rising elevation means more water.

What this page is not
Monitoring records are irregular: measurements cluster where somebody chose to look, so a trend describes this well's record, not the aquifer as a whole. Levels are DWR's published measurements, unedited. A trend here is not a prediction, and it is not a determination about anyone's water right.
